# Env file — Cartwheel dispatch, driver-assignment heuristic
# Scope: staging only. Do not promote to prod.
# The heuristic weights (proximity, shift balance, refusal rate) are tuned
# for the Velmont pilot region and will misbehave elsewhere.
# Review notes: heuristic service runs unprivileged; it reads weights
# read-only from the tuning store and writes nothing back.
# Only one sensitive value exists in this file: the tuning-store access
# credential, consumed at boot and never logged.
# That credential is set on the following line.

secret setting of faduf-bahop: LEDGER_TOKEN8=c3b363be

## Formula sandbox tuning

User-supplied formulas in Gridmoor execute inside a restricted interpreter with hard ceilings on time, memory, and call depth. Reviewers should confirm any change to these ceilings is justified in the PR description, since raising them widens the abuse surface. Defaults were chosen from production traces. The current limits are as follows.

limits module of tafog-fawip:
WEIGHTS = {
    "julix": 57,
    "lamys": 992,
    "kasvan": 209,
    "quenok": 750,
    "alddor": 259,
    "oliath": 1009,
    "wenix": 815,
}

The garage occupancy feed for the Brindlewood campus arrives over a message queue every thirty seconds, one record per level, published by the Stallgrid edge boxes. Counts can briefly go negative when a sensor double-fires on exit; the ingest job clamps these to zero and flags the interval. If the feed stalls for more than five minutes, the dashboard falls back to the last known snapshot. Sensor mappings, queue names, and the replay procedure are documented on the internal page below.

runbook for tahog-kadug: https://gitlab.qirvanworks.corp/projects/pages/view/b139298aed28

## Undo/Redo in Sketchloom

For the security review: undo and redo in the Sketchloom diagram editor are command-log based. Every mutation is appended to a per-document history table; redo replays forward entries. History is never sent to the client raw — only diffs. The history table lives in the primary store, reachable via the connection string below.

replica DSN, tadup-fahif: clickhouse://fraiel_svc:OXtAM8cj4MFYZH@db-ce5e.braskdata.example:5432/fraeth